Summary

The MAR-1 antibody reacts with the Fc epsilon Receptor I alpha chain (FceRIa), a transmembrane protein member of the Ig superfamily. This chain, together with a beta chain and two gamma chains form a tetrameric complex that supports IgE-mediated signaling and subsequent release of chemical mediators of allergy and immediate hypersensitivity. FceR1a is upregulated in the presence of IgE on those cell types which express it, such as Mast cells and Basophils.The MAR-1 antibody is widely used both in flow cytometry and for depletion of cells in vitro / in vivo.

Background

The immunoglobulin epsilon receptor (IgE receptor) is the initiator of the allergic response. When two or more high-affinity IgE receptors are brought together by allergen-bound IgE molecules, mediators such as histamine that are responsible for allergy symptoms are released. This receptor is comprised of an alpha subunit, a beta subunit, and two gamma subunits. The protein encoded by this gene represents the alpha subunit. [provided by RefSeq, Aug 2011]
